/* $Id$ */
 | 
						|
/*
 | 
						|
 * (c) copyright 1987 by the Vrije Universiteit, Amsterdam, The Netherlands.
 | 
						|
 * See the copyright notice in the ACK home directory, in the file "Copyright".
 | 
						|
 */
 | 
						|
/*	Change IDentifiers occurring in C programs outside comment, strings
 | 
						|
	and character constants.
 | 
						|
	-Dname=text	: replace all occerences of name by text
 | 
						|
	-Dname		: same as -Dname=
 | 
						|
	-Ffile		: read sentences of the from name=text from file
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	Author: Erik Baalbergen
 | 
						|
	Date: Oct 23, 1985
 | 
						|
*/
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#include <stdio.h>
 | 
						|
#include <string.h>
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#ifndef DEF_LENGTH
 | 
						|
#define DEF_LENGTH	8
 | 
						|
#endif
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#define LINE_LEN	1024
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#define HASHSIZE 257
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
struct idf {
 | 
						|
	struct idf *id_next;
 | 
						|
	char *id_name;
 | 
						|
	char *id_text;
 | 
						|
};
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
struct idf *hash_tab[HASHSIZE];
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
char *Malloc(), *Salloc();
 | 
						|
struct idf *FindId();
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
extern char *ProgName;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
DoOption(str)
 | 
						|
	char *str;
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
	switch (str[1]) {
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	case 'D':
 | 
						|
		DoMacro(&str[2]);
 | 
						|
		break;
 | 
						|
	
 | 
						|
	case 'F':
 | 
						|
		GetMacros(&str[2]);
 | 
						|
		break;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	default:
 | 
						|
		fprintf(stderr, "%s: bad option \"%s\"\n", ProgName, str);
 | 
						|
		break;
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
/*ARGSUSED*/
 | 
						|
CheckId(id, len)
 | 
						|
	char *id;
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
	struct idf *idp = FindId(id);
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	if (idp) {
 | 
						|
		printf("%s", idp->id_text);
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
	else {
 | 
						|
		printf("%s", id);
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
DoMacro(str)
 | 
						|
	char *str;
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
	char *id, *text;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	id = str++;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	while (*str != '\0' && *str != '=') {
 | 
						|
		str++;
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	if (*str == '=') {
 | 
						|
		*str++ = '\0';
 | 
						|
		text = str;
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
	else {
 | 
						|
		text = "";
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	InsertMacro(id, text);
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
GetMacros(fn)
 | 
						|
	char *fn;
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
	FILE *fp;
 | 
						|
	register c;
 | 
						|
	char buf[LINE_LEN];
 | 
						|
	char *bufp = &buf[0];
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	if ((fp = fopen(fn, "r")) == NULL) {
 | 
						|
		fprintf(stderr, "%s: cannot read file \"%s\"\n", ProgName, fn);
 | 
						|
		return;
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	while ((c = getc(fp)) != EOF) {
 | 
						|
		if (c == '\n' && bufp != &buf[0]) {
 | 
						|
			*bufp = '\0';
 | 
						|
			DoMacro(&buf[0]);
 | 
						|
			bufp = &buf[0];
 | 
						|
		}
 | 
						|
		else {
 | 
						|
			*bufp++ = c;
 | 
						|
		}
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
	fclose(fp);
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
InsertMacro(id, text)
 | 
						|
	char *id, *text;
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
	int hash_val = EnHash(id);
 | 
						|
	struct idf *idp = hash_tab[hash_val];
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	while (idp) {
 | 
						|
		if (strcmp(idp->id_name, id) == 0) {
 | 
						|
			fprintf(stderr, "%s: (warning) redefinition of %s\n",
 | 
						|
				ProgName, id);
 | 
						|
			break;
 | 
						|
		}
 | 
						|
		idp = idp->id_next;
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	if (idp == 0) {
 | 
						|
		idp = (struct idf *) Malloc(sizeof(struct idf));
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	idp->id_next = hash_tab[hash_val];
 | 
						|
	idp->id_name = Salloc(id);
 | 
						|
	idp->id_text = Salloc(text);
 | 
						|
	hash_tab[hash_val] = idp;
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
char *
 | 
						|
Malloc(n)
 | 
						|
	unsigned n;
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
	char *mem, *malloc();
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	if ((mem = malloc(n)) == 0) {
 | 
						|
		fprintf(stderr, "%s: out of memory\n", ProgName);
 | 
						|
		exit(1);
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
	return mem;
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
char *
 | 
						|
Salloc(str)
 | 
						|
	char *str;
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
	if (str == 0) {
 | 
						|
		str = "";
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
	return strcpy(Malloc((unsigned)strlen(str) + 1), str);
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
struct idf *
 | 
						|
FindId(id)
 | 
						|
	char *id;
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
	register hash_val = EnHash(id);
 | 
						|
	register struct idf *idp = hash_tab[hash_val];
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	while (idp) {
 | 
						|
		if (strcmp(idp->id_name, id) == 0) {
 | 
						|
			return idp;
 | 
						|
		}
 | 
						|
		idp = idp->id_next;
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
	return 0;
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
EnHash(id)
 | 
						|
	char *id;
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
	register unsigned hash_val = 0;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	while (*id) {
 | 
						|
		hash_val = 31 * hash_val + *id++;
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	return hash_val % (unsigned) HASHSIZE;
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
extern int GCcopy;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
BeginOfProgram()
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
	GCcopy = 1;
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
EndOfProgram()
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
}
